Stephen Oreski is a psychotherapist specializing in individual, couples and family therapy, and maintains a private practice in Paramus, New Jersey. With over 15 years experience as a marriage and family therapist, and as a graduate of Fordham University specializing in trauma-focused cognitive behavioral therapy, he is currently serving as private practitioner working with a broad spectrum of clients. In addition to being a prominent relationship therapist, Stephen has presented at National conferences and to general audiences speaking on the topics of mental illness and trauma.
Stephen Oreski is an interactive, solution-focused therapist. His therapeutic approach is to provide support and practical feedback to help clients effectively address personal life challenges. He integrates complementary methodologies and techniques to offer a highly personalized approach tailored to each client.
With compassion and understanding, he works with each individual to help them build on their strengths and attain the personal growth they are committed to accomplishing.
